summaryrefslogtreecommitdiffstats
path: root/src
Commit message (Expand)AuthorAgeFilesLines
* Fuzzy check uses already normalized words.Vsevolod Stakhov2015-02-231-35/+2
* Add routines to normalize text parts.Vsevolod Stakhov2015-02-233-0/+54
* Add lowercase utility for utf8 strings.Vsevolod Stakhov2015-02-232-0/+32
* Configurable min_word_len.Vsevolod Stakhov2015-02-234-1/+11
* Use xxh64 for upstreams hashing.Vsevolod Stakhov2015-02-231-8/+3
* Allow configurable tokenizers.Vsevolod Stakhov2015-02-225-17/+44
* Move cdb to contrib as well.Vsevolod Stakhov2015-02-217-998/+1
* Remove submodules.Vsevolod Stakhov2015-02-212-0/+0
* Move ucl and rdns to contrib.Vsevolod Stakhov2015-02-211-5/+0
* Allow customizations for unix sockets.Vsevolod Stakhov2015-02-202-12/+102
* More fixes to urls parser.Vsevolod Stakhov2015-02-201-40/+39
* Initialize variable earlier.Vsevolod Stakhov2015-02-201-1/+2
* Rework url detection and decoding.Vsevolod Stakhov2015-02-201-215/+81
* Add uri unescape from nginx.Vsevolod Stakhov2015-02-192-2/+98
* Allow url parser seting the end of url.Vsevolod Stakhov2015-02-191-33/+42
* Improve some cases of IDN urls.Vsevolod Stakhov2015-02-191-8/+4
* Write parser for urls.Vsevolod Stakhov2015-02-191-6/+275
* Fix radix comparision for partial masks.Vsevolod Stakhov2015-02-191-4/+0
* Fix includes.Vsevolod Stakhov2015-02-181-7/+0
* Invalidate learned files to update their content.Vsevolod Stakhov2015-02-184-0/+18
* Implement statistics relearning.Vsevolod Stakhov2015-02-185-15/+72
* Allow sqlite3 cache customization.Vsevolod Stakhov2015-02-183-5/+35
* Save classifier options.Vsevolod Stakhov2015-02-181-0/+1
* Improve emails parsing (mentioned at #181).Vsevolod Stakhov2015-02-181-5/+58
* Fix emails parsing.Vsevolod Stakhov2015-02-172-9/+132
* Stop regexp flags parsing on the first bad flag.Vsevolod Stakhov2015-02-171-1/+2
* Merge pull request #177 from fatalbanana/masterVsevolod Stakhov2015-02-171-11/+67
|\
| * Since exclude_private_ips requires config to change behaviour now we can make...Andrew Lewis2015-02-171-1/+1
| * Support emails dnsblAndrew Lewis2015-02-171-1/+50
| * Make local/private IP exclusions work for all RBL typesAndrew Lewis2015-02-171-4/+14
| * Unbreak operation of rbl.lua in certain instancesAndrew Lewis2015-02-171-5/+2
* | Treat '__' symbols as ghost symbols.Vsevolod Stakhov2015-02-172-4/+12
* | Add the concept of ghost symbols.Vsevolod Stakhov2015-02-172-3/+11
* | Set lua path for lua configuration.Vsevolod Stakhov2015-02-173-1/+11
* | Email usernames can contain atom symbols.Vsevolod Stakhov2015-02-171-4/+4
* | Fix regexp creating from // pattern.Vsevolod Stakhov2015-02-171-2/+2
* | Add other rules types.Vsevolod Stakhov2015-02-161-0/+43
* | Allow to use SA header rules.Vsevolod Stakhov2015-02-161-1/+40
* | Merge pull request #174 from fatalbanana/masterVsevolod Stakhov2015-02-162-38/+79
|\|
| * Fix incorrect processing of exclusionsAndrew Lewis2015-02-161-5/+7
| * Use radix for private IP exclusions in rbl.luaAndrew Lewis2015-02-161-33/+8
| * Add rspamd_config:radix_from_config()Andrew Lewis2015-02-161-0/+57
| * Make local exclusions configurable per-RBLAndrew Lewis2015-02-161-4/+11
* | Start spamassasin rules reader plugin.Vsevolod Stakhov2015-02-161-0/+129
* | Do not set lua path when cfg is not loaded.Vsevolod Stakhov2015-02-161-2/+1
* | Set lua path according to rspamd settings.Vsevolod Stakhov2015-02-161-0/+37
* | Remove useless library.Vsevolod Stakhov2015-02-161-2/+0
* | Allow definitions of composite rules from lua.Vsevolod Stakhov2015-02-151-0/+55
|/
* Don't use to_number() when checking radix mapsAndrew Lewis2015-02-152-5/+3
* Merge remote-tracking branch 'upstream/master'Andrew Lewis2015-02-151-1/+1
|\